Steven Spielberg recently opened up about his experience with Interstellar, a project he worked on for a year before passing it to Christopher Nolan. Originally brought in by Kip Thorne and producer Lynda Obst, Spielberg explored the scientific aspects at the Jet Propulsion Laboratory in Pasadena, California.

Despite his initial enthusiasm and hiring Jonathan Nolan for script drafts, he felt the project wasn’t shaping up. Jonathan suggested that if Spielberg withdrew, Christopher was a prime candidate to carry on with the film. Spielberg expressed satisfaction with how Interstellar turned out, highlighting Nolan's expertise in crafting a masterful sci-fi narrative.
